前回のサイト制作日記②で、YouTubeのAPIについての苦労した話(現在進行中か笑)をお話ししました。
今回は、InstagramのAPI設定話を・・・
今回Instagramのデータを取得するために使用したのは、『Instagram グラフ API』です。
面倒くさいところと言えば、facebookとの連携したり、発行されるトークンが短期間でつけなくなるのを防ぐために無期限トークンに変換するのがまじで面倒くさい笑
まあなんだかんだで、無期限トークンや、InstagramビジネスIDが取得できたので、あとはいざ実装!
と、結構実装自体は簡単だったのですが、なぜかAPI以外のところで問題が・・・笑
全てのSNSのAPI問題が解決できたので、『よっしゃー!サイト公開するかー!』と思って公開設定していたら、なぜかInstagram グラフ APIでエラーが・・・
というのも、なぜかInstagram本体側で本人確認ができません的な感じになっていました・・・
確かに、Instagramはfacebookと連携する必要があるので、Instagramの設定はぴーやドットゲームズとして設定、facebook側は本名で設定していたためエラーが起きていたっぽい?
いや俺だよっ!っていう証明のために送られてきたコードと写真を撮って送ってくれ。じゃないといつまでも見れないぞー的な連絡があったので、それを送って2日ほどで解除されました・・・
面倒くさいけど、なりすまし防止のためなのかなー?というか原因が上記の理由で確定なのかは正直分からない笑
また、連携が外れて・・・とかなるの嫌だなぁ・・・
もしエラーが出ていたら、優しく教えてくださいね笑
ということで、今回はInstagramについてのあれこれでした!
次回は、Twitter APIについてを・・・